Story In one of five short films, Alice finds herself in an unknown world after stumbling down a hole. She hears about a doctor, who may be able to help her return home. After finding the doctor, she realizes that her reality is shattered.

Title Concept We are taking aspects of the original Alice in Wonderland book and film and mixing it with the revised Wasteland version. The titles will begin as Alice “dreams”. She falls down a hole and sees items falling with her. The items begin to change in theme the further down she goes. The end of the titles will foreshadow the end for Alice.

Treatment

We will create the assets in Cinema 4D, Photoshop, Illustrator and After Effects.

Sequence

The camera is the POV of Alice. She is falling from the sky, passes through clouds and falls towards the ground to a field of daisies. The daisies rot away and spell out the title of the film. She falls into a hole, where she sees a light bulb which turns on revealing other items in the hole.

Sequence Items she see’s as she falls down the hole are: frames with tea party supplies and CAT eyes tea pot pouring blood onto white roses that turn red which drip blood onto paper the paper turns into playing cards which pair up and form into butterflies a mirror appears, but before you see her reflection it fuzzes and the CAT appears

Typographic Treatments

The title will be written within the flowers. Other typographic elements will be coded. Text elements will differ from one another and will change in theme as the fall progresses.
